A Career Advancement Programme in Transition Metal Complexes offers specialized training designed to boost professional skills in the field of inorganic chemistry. The program focuses on the synthesis, characterization, and applications of transition metal complexes, equipping participants with advanced knowledge and practical experience.
Learning outcomes include mastering advanced synthetic techniques for transition metal complexes, proficiency in characterization methods like NMR, X-ray crystallography, and UV-Vis spectroscopy, and a deep understanding of their catalytic applications in various fields. Participants will also develop strong problem-solving skills and advanced data analysis capabilities, crucial for research and development roles.
The duration of such a program can vary, typically ranging from six months to two years, depending on the intensity and level of specialization. Some programs offer modular options for flexible learning tailored to individual needs and career goals. This flexibility caters to both experienced professionals seeking career enhancement and recent graduates starting their career path in coordination chemistry.
